  • Typology: face and body repair cream with acid pH.
  • Action: protective, soothing, repairing, re-epithelialising, antibacterial, antifungal, antioxidant, healing.
  • Active ingredients: mimosa tenuiflora extract (standardised in polyphenols), bergamot essential oil.
  • Directions: sensitive and reddened skin, irritation, itching, eczema, burns, dermatitis, folliculitis, acne manifestations, insect bites, nappy rash, pre-post peeling, aesthetic medicine, tattoos
  • Skin type: all skin types, the whole family (babies, children, adults, the elderly)
  • Frequency of application: apply morning and/or evening to the affected areas of face and body, massaging in until completely absorbed. Can also be used as required
  • Production: Max Pier Cosmetics Laboratories, Mantua (Made in Italy)

INCI
Aqua (Water), Glycerin, Cetyl Alcohol, Glyceryl Stearate, Ethylhexyl Palmitate, Propylene Glycol, Palmitic Acid, Stearic Acid, Caprylic/Capric Triglyceride, Glyceryl Stearate SE, Citrus Aurantium Bergamia Leaf Oil (Citrus Aurantium Bergamia (Bergamot) Leaf Oil), Mimosa Tenuiflora Bark Extract, Ethylhexylglycerin, Lanolin, Sodium Dehydroacetate, Phenoxyethanol, Disodium EDTA, Linalool, Limonene

Mimosa tenuiflora: the repairing extract that protects the skin

Mimosa tenuiflora is a plant with a history stretching back thousands of years. Even the Maya used it to aid wound healing, so much so that they called it the 'skin tree'. In Mimosa sour cream, its extract (standardised in polyphenols) is at the heart of the formula. It has a acquisitive and documented pharmacological action: anti-inflammatory,soothing,antioxidant,healing,re-epithelising,antibacterial and anti-fungal.

This means that it does more than just soothe a symptom. It works in depth to support the regeneration of the epidermis, increase tissue resistance and make the skin more elastic and protected against external aggression. Bergamot essential oil, sebum-regulating and purifying, completes the formula with disinfectant and astringent properties that help keep the skin clean and balanced.

The cream's acid pH is another distinguishing feature: it respects and strengthens the natural hydrolipid mantle, that thin barrier that protects the skin from bacteria, fungi and irritants. When this balance is altered (due to stress, atmospheric agents or aggressive treatments) the skin becomes fragile, reactive and prone to redness and impurities. Mimosa acid cream helps to restore it.
